The Mechanics of Match-Three Gameplay

At the heart of many of these engaging experiences lies the match-three mechanic. It’s a seemingly simple premise: align three or more identical elements to eliminate them from the board and earn points. However, the devil is in the details. The design of the game board, the types of elements included, and the cascading effects of matches all contribute to the overall gameplay experience. Developers utilize these elements to create a dynamic and unpredictable environment. The introduction of special elements, created by matching four or more pieces, adds another layer of complexity. These special pieces often possess unique abilities, such as clearing entire rows or columns, or detonating surrounding elements, drastically altering the game state. The integration of these power-ups isn’t arbitrary; they are strategically introduced to help players overcome difficult obstacles and maintain engagement.

The Role of Randomness and Skill

While luck certainly plays a role in the initial arrangement of elements on the board, skillful play is essential for achieving high scores and progressing through the game. Identifying potential match opportunities, planning several moves ahead, and strategically utilizing special elements are all crucial skills. Successful players learn to anticipate the cascading effects of their actions and to prioritize matches that will create chain reactions. This requires a degree of spatial reasoning and strategic thinking. The challenge lies in maximizing the impact of each move, turning a seemingly random arrangement into a stream of cascading rewards. The randomness balances the game and means an element of unpredictability is always present.

Variable Ratio Reinforcement Schedules

The effectiveness of these games can be further understood through the lens of behavioral psychology, specifically the concept of variable ratio reinforcement schedules. This means that rewards are not delivered after a predictable number of actions, but rather at random intervals. This unpredictability makes the rewards even more potent, as players are constantly anticipating the next big win. Think of a slot machine; the erratic nature of the payouts is precisely what makes it so captivating. Similarly, in match-three games, the appearance of special elements and the creation of cascading combos are unpredictable, adding an element of excitement and anticipation to each gameplay session. Players are consistently engaged trying to get that next rewarding sequence. This system ensures that engagement levels are high.

Understanding Cascading Combos

A key strategic element is the concept of cascading combos. These occur when one match triggers a chain reaction, leading to further matches and a substantial increase in points. Mastering the art of creating cascading combos requires a deep understanding of the game's physics and the potential consequences of each move. Players must be able to visualize how elements will fall and interact, anticipating the ripple effect of their actions. This often involves sacrificing short-term gains for the potential of a larger, more lucrative combo. Skillful players are able to orchestrate these cascades, transforming a seemingly unfavorable board into a whirlwind of points and rewards. These combos can offer gamers a significant boost to both their score and enjoyment.

The Evolution of the Genre: Beyond Candies

The initial success of games like Candy Crush Saga sparked a wave of imitators, but the genre has evolved considerably since its early days. Developers have experimented with new themes, mechanics, and gameplay modes, pushing the boundaries of what's possible within the match-three framework. We’ve seen games that incorporate RPG elements, narrative storytelling, and even multiplayer competition. The key to success lies in innovation – finding new ways to engage players and keep the experience fresh. While the basic premise of matching remains consistent, the surrounding elements have been drastically altered to provide a novel experience for players. The introduction of new mechanics, such as tile-swapping limitations or unique element properties, adds an additional layer of challenge and complexity.
